Few figures in world sport have left a mark as deep and lasting as Diego Armando Maradona. In Buenos Aires, his presence is not confined to history books or highlight reels — it lives in the streets, the murals, the cafes, and the quiet corners of the barrio where he grew up.
This tour is structured around authentic, lesser-known sites that reveal the human side of Maradona — the boy who arrived in La Paternal as a teenager, the young footballer who trained at Argentinos Juniors, and the icon whose passing gave rise to spontaneous acts of collective mourning and devotion. Each stop adds a layer to a story that is inseparable from Argentine identity.

Step inside the house where a fifteen-year-old Diego Maradona first settled with his family after moving to La Paternal. Preserved with care, the interior remains much as it was during his early years, offering a rare and intimate window into his life before fame.
Visit the stadium where Maradona launched his professional career and learn the full history of how he came to join the club. Colourful murals surrounding the area depict key moments from his career at Napoli, Barcelona, and the Argentine national team.
This outdoor shrine, built and maintained by devoted fans, holds an extraordinary collection of jerseys, footballs, statues, and personal tributes. It stands as a testament to the enduring emotional connection between Maradona and the people who loved him.
